From fruit-bodies of the Japanese mushroom Boletus laetissimus two polyene
pigments boleto-crocin A and B were isolated and their structures determine
d by spectroscopic methods. The compounds represent diamides of hexadecahep
taenedioic acid with isoleucine and either aspartic acid or asparagine. The
L-configuration of the amino acids was established after acid hydrolysis.
The structures of five structurally related minor pigments were elucidated
by LC-ESIMS. (C) 1998 Published by Elsevier Science Ltd. All rights reserve
